The project team showed a new CR-4 ‘pinwheel’ massing for 201 Oak Avenue after recent zoning changes; the board welcomed improved accessibility and two remote exits but asked for stronger material articulation and pedestrian-level views.

An applicant team presented a reworked design for 201 Oak Avenue on April 22 after the city’s rezoning in the surrounding area. The team said they changed the proposal from an earlier CR-3 approach to a CR-4-compliant scheme that consolidates massing into a pinwheel plan with four sub-facade expressions to meet maximum façade-length rules.
